Pine wood siding installation involves attaching high-quality pine planks or panels to the exterior walls of a property. This process typically includes preparing the surface, measuring and cutting the siding to fit precisely, and securely fastening the wood to ensure durability and a polished appearance. Skilled service providers can help homeowners select the right type of pine siding, whether traditional lap siding, shingles, or paneling, to match the architectural style of the property. Proper installation not only enhances the visual appeal but also provides a protective barrier against the elements, helping to extend the lifespan of the building’s exterior.

The overview below groups typical Pine Wood Siding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Trenton, NJ.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or repairs or patching of pine wood siding usually range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, reflecting common repair needs for local homes. Fewer projects tend to push into the higher tiers unless additional work is required.

Partial Replacement - Replacing sections of pine wood siding often costs between $1,200 and $3,500, depending on the size and complexity of the area. Local contractors generally handle these projects regularly within this range, with larger or more intricate jobs reaching higher costs.

Full Siding Replacement - Complete installation of pine wood siding for an average home can range from $4,000 to $8,000. Many full replacements fall into this range, though larger or custom projects may exceed $10,000 depending on scope and materials.

Larger, Custom Projects - Extensive or complex pine siding installations, such as on larger homes or with specialty finishes, can reach $10,000 or more. These projects are less common and typically involve higher material costs and labor for detailed work.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of choosing pine wood siding for a home? Pine wood siding offers a natural appearance, durability, and the ability to be painted or stained to match various styles, making it a versatile choice for many homeowners in Trenton and nearby areas.

How is pine wood siding installed on a building? Local contractors typically prepare the wall surface, then securely attach the pine boards using nails or screws, ensuring proper spacing and alignment for a smooth, even finish.

What maintenance is required for pine wood siding? Pine wood siding generally needs regular cleaning, and periodic staining or sealing to protect against moisture and pests, helping to prolong its appearance and lifespan.

Can pine wood siding be customized or painted after installation? Yes, pine wood siding can be painted or stained after installation, allowing homeowners to personalize the look and match it with other exterior elements.
